Bilateral Boost: 40 teachers sent to learn more about teaching

A total of 200 teachers from all over Pakistan have participated in the four week PELI training project held in US.


Express October 02, 2011

KARACHI:


The Pakistan Education Leadership (PELI) experience has opened new windows of learning and understanding for me, said Reform Support Unit Monitoring and Evaluation Officer Zahid Hussain Jatoi at a conference on Friday.


“Through this programme, I have learnt that teaching and learning is not limited to the four walls of a classroom.” Zahid was one of the 40 teachers who participated in the four week PELI project for Pakistani teachers in the United States.

So far, 200 teachers have participated in this project from all over the country. Baela Raza Jamil of the Idara-e-Taleem-o-Aagahi said that in order for the country to move forward we should try to solve the problems in the education sector.

Pakistan-US Alumni Network President Fauzia Siddiqi said that it was important to continue and encourage such programme because they would help bridge the gap between the two countries. Press release
